The Problem

After a long meeting, the minutes document is 10+ pages of detailed notes, discussions, tangents, and action items. Team members who missed the meeting need to get up to speed, but asking them to read the full minutes means most people won't — and important action items get missed.

The Solution

Upload the meeting minutes and get a concise AI summary that highlights the key decisions made, action items with owners, deadlines, and the most important discussion points — everything an absent colleague needs to know in 2 minutes instead of 20.
